§ 611.271 — COPIES OF DOCUMENTS; FEES

Text

The court administrators of courts, the prosecuting attorneys of counties and municipalities, and the law enforcement agencies of the state and its political subdivisions shall furnish, upon the request of the district public defender, the state public defender, or an attorney working for a public defense corporation under section611.216, copies of any documents in their possession at no charge to the public defender, including the following: police reports, photographs, copies of existing grand jury transcripts, audiotapes, videotapes, audio or video files on CD Rom or DVD Rom disc, copies of existing transcripts of audiotapes, videotapes, or audio or video files on CD Rom or DVD Rom disc and, in child protection cases, reports prepared by local welfare agencies. Legislative History

1969 c 655 s 5;1Sp1986 c 3 art 1 s 82;1990 c 604 art 9 s 10;1992 c 571 art 15 s 4;1993 c 146 art 2 s 26;1996 c 408 art 11 s 8;2010 c 239 s 1
